Welcome to a compelling journey through the dynamic landscape of brand leadership, meticulously explored in "Warriors on the High Wire: The Balancing Act of Brand Leadership in the 21st Century." In an era where brands are no longer just markers of identity but engines of connectivity and innovation, this book provides a comprehensive exploration of the principles and practices that define effective brand stewardship today.
The modern brand leader operates much like a wire walker, balancing the immense pressures of market dynamics, consumer expectations, technological advancements, and socio-cultural shifts. "Warriors on the High Wire" delves into the intricate balancing act required to maintain a brand's relevance, resilience, and resonance in today's complex global marketplace.
The book is structured to take the reader through a sequence of essential concepts, strategies, and case studies. It begins by focusing on the fundamentals of brand identity and the evolution of branding in response to digital transformation. It further explores how leaders can harness technology and data analytics to craft intuitive brand strategies.
Midway, it examines the role of ethics, sustainability, and corporate social responsibility in brand management, highlighting how conscientious leadership can embody and enact brand values that align with consumer values. Finally, it addresses crisis management and reputation recovery, offering insights into how brand leaders can navigate through adversity with agility and integrity.
